Abstract:
The presence or absence of objects is determined by interrogating or exciting transponders coupled to the objects using pulsed wide band frequency signals. Interrogation is broken down into a number of subsample scan cycles each having interrogation cycles a start time forward in time by a fraction of a period of an expected transponder response signal. Ambient or background noise is evaluated and a threshold adjusted based on the level of noise. Adjustment may be based on multiple noise measurements or samples. Noise detection may be limited, with emphasis placed on interrogation to increase the signal to noise ratio. Matched filtering may be employed. Presence/absence determination may take into account frequency and/or Q value to limit false detections. Appropriate acts may be taken if detected noise is out of defined limits of operation, for example shutting down interrogation and/or providing an appropriate indication.
Abstract:
The invention provides an image display processing device and an image display processing program for displaying information concerning diagnosis of correspondence with an RF tag. The image display processing device includes a unit for obtaining diagnostic information concerning correspondence when correspondence between the RF tag and an RFID reader/writer has been successful, and a display controller configured to make a display unit display an image based on the diagnostic information. The diagnostic information includes correspondence margin based on a characteristic value obtained from the correspondence signal.

Abstract:
During the data reading process, data is stored in an electronic device (10) incorporated into a tyre identified by a registration number and a week of manufacture number, the device (10) comprising data storage means (20), the storage means (20) comprising a data storage zone comprising a storage interval in the form of bits, this interval being known as a restricted interval and comprising a number of bits less than or equal to 38. During the process: the data stored in the restricted interval is read; and the read data is decoded in order to determine the registration number and the week number of the tyre.
Abstract:
Provided are an RFID tag movement distinguishing method and an RFID tag movement distinguishing program with which are an RFID tag that has moved in front of an antenna and an RFID tag that is static are identified based on chronological data of received radio wave strength, a phase, or a Doppler frequency of a read RFID tag obtained from a general RFID reader and a general antenna. Chronological read data of a plurality of RFID tags including a moving RFID tag and a static RFID tag is acquired by an RFID reader, and the static RFID tag is specified by a static RFID tag filter based on information of a plurality of read RFID tags based on a certain parameter. In the RFID tag movement distinguishing method, the static RFID tag filter identifies the moving RFID tag by identifying the static RFID tag and the moving RFID tag using at least one or more of individual static RFID tag filter among a quick-read filter, an RSSI absolute value filter, an RSSI non-contiguous increase filter, an RSSI valley-shaped filter, an excess read filter, a phase shift reduction filter, and a vertical direction movement filter.

Abstract:
A system for controlling shopping carts usage in the vicinity of a parking lot, the system comprising: a device that repeatedly transmits a lock command from a directional antenna (282), said directional antenna mounted above ground and angled downward to create a lock zone (286) in which shopping cart use is restricted, said lock zone encompassing an exit area associated with the parking lot; and a plurality of shopping carts, each shopping cart comprising a brake mechanism, and comprising an RF communication circuit that is responsive to the lock command by activating the brake mechanism.
